The Courteeners Release New Music Video For 'Modern Love'

Publish date: 2024-05-19

The Courteeners have released their video for new single ‘Modern Love’.

The track, taken from the bands fifth studio Mapping The Rendezvous, was co-written with The Hurts.

Speaking exclusively to NME about the song, Courteeners lead guitarist Liam Fray said “this is the first time we’ve written a song with other people.”

“It was a co-write with the guys from Hurts. We’ve know them for over 10 years and have a pretty good friendship.”

“They sent our producer a song, and they didn’t like it. It was very ‘them’ – a bit ’80s but full on. But I was like ‘I love this track’.”

‘Modern Love’ serves as the third single from Mapping The Rendezvous following ‘The 17th’ and ‘No One Will Ever Replace Us’.

Mapping The Rendezvous was met with mixed reviews upon its release last year.

NME described the record as if “they’d only made half of a very good album”, but Hotpress disagreed stating The Courteeners “break out of their indie-pop straitjacket; the results are riveting.”

Speaking about the inspiration behind the album Liam Fray said “The album was inspired by the film ‘Victoria’ – one snapshot of a big night out.”

“It’s romantic, it’s sad, you’re making bad decisions, you regret it in the morning, you do it all again the next night.”

“It’s about living fast. He’s just following his muse around Paris and it’s beautiful.”

The Courteeners will play Manchester Emirates Old Trafford LCCC on Saturday, May 27th.

Also on the bill are The Charlatans, Blossoms & Cabbage.
